Here's another cold weather problem. I'm having starting problems at
high altitude, (8500 ft.) and 0 deg. F., after sitting over night. I've
tried checking the resistance on the sensor on the back of the engine,
but that seems ok. I haven't tried pulling VAG codes, but will do that
next. I was told by Fred Munro that the engine has a cold starting
procedure that allows the injectors to spray longer at lower
temperatures, but I don't know how to check that it is going into the
cold starting mode. Has anyone else seen this problem?
It will eventually start when I jump the battery to a car that has the
engine running, but can't get it to fire otherwise.
